"treats" for the plastic eggs?

Whether is food/candy or other items looking for some ideas to add to my very small list. Thanks!

Re: "treats" for the plastic eggs?

  • annie's bunny crackers, chocolate chips, mini cheese or pb cracker sandwiches (trader joe's), yogurt raisins, stickers, finger/ring crayons (they have them at target), barrettes/bows for girls

  • Last year, I put a new piggy bank in her basket, so I put pennies in the eggs.  She spent at least an hour placing the pennies in her new bank.  This year, I am going to buy a puzzle and put one piece into each egg.
  • non-food things: temporary tatoos, stickers, small bubble jars (they need the big eggs, but fit), those little craft toys made from a fuzz ball and ears or feet and googly eyes that look like things like ducks and chicks.
